An Exquisite Seven-Course Experience Crafted by Chef Ryuki Kawasaki

The heart of Mezzaluna's magic lies in its seasonal seven-course tasting menu, priced at THB 8,000 per person, which showcases the freshest ingredients in innovative ways. Signature dishes like the Lobster Ravioli, Sous-Vide Lamb, and Truffle-Infused Risotto exemplify the chef’s commitment to culinary artistry and balance. Each plate is thoughtfully paired with an extensive wine selection, including Bordeaux, Burgundy, and sake, expertly curated to complement the nuanced flavors of the menu.

Mezzaluna: A pinnacle of fine dining in Bangkok's skyline

Perched dramatically on the 65th floor of the iconic Lebua Hotel in Bangkok, Mezzaluna has established itself as a beacon of culinary excellence since it opened its doors in 2005. This luxurious restaurant combines the artistry of French and Japanese cuisine, crafting an unforgettable dining experience that attracts both locals and travelers seeking the best in fine dining.

A journey of culinary mastery and recognition

The story of Mezzaluna took a decisive turn in 2017 with the arrival of Chef Ryuki Kawasaki, a master of blending French and Japanese techniques. His visionary leadership elevated the restaurant's offerings, focusing on seasonal menus that highlight fresh, high-quality ingredients sourced thoughtfully to create innovative and exquisite dishes. These efforts were rewarded with their first Michelin star in 2019, followed by a prestigious second star in 2021, cementing Mezzaluna's status among Bangkok's elite dining establishments.

Key milestones in Mezzaluna's history

  • 2005: Mezzaluna opens on the 65th floor of the Lebua Hotel in Bangkok, setting a new standard for luxury dining.
  • 2017: Chef Ryuki Kawasaki joins Mezzaluna, infusing the menu with his expert fusion of French and Japanese culinary arts.
  • 2019: Mezzaluna earns its first Michelin star, a testament to its culinary innovation and quality.
  • 2021: Awarded its second Michelin star, Mezzaluna solidifies its reputation as one of Bangkok's most distinguished dining experiences.
